When To Upsize Microsoft Access To SQL Server Los Angeles



Value of Microsoft Access in Your Organization
Mid to big companies could have hundreds to hundreds of home computer. Each desktop computer has standard software program that allows staff to accomplish computer jobs without the treatment of the organization's IT division. This offers the primary tenet of desktop computer: empowering individuals to enhance performance as well as reduced costs with decentralized computing.

As the world's most prominent desktop computer data source, Microsoft Gain access to is used in almost all companies that utilize Microsoft Windows. As users come to be much more skillful in the operation of these applications, they begin to recognize options to service tasks that they themselves could carry out. The natural evolution of this process is that spreadsheets and also data sources are developed and preserved by end-users to manage their everyday jobs.

This vibrant allows both productivity as well as agility as individuals are encouraged to address service issues without the treatment of their organization's Infotech facilities. Microsoft Accessibility matches this room by supplying a desktop computer data source setting where end-users can quickly develop database applications with tables, queries, forms and also records. Gain access to is excellent for low-cost solitary individual or workgroup database applications.

Yet this power has a price. As even more customers utilize Microsoft Access to manage their job, problems of data protection, dependability, maintainability, scalability as well as management become intense. Individuals who developed these solutions are hardly ever trained to be database specialists, developers or system administrators. As data sources outgrow the capabilities of the initial author, they should move right into a more durable environment.

While some individuals consider this a reason why end-users should not ever before utilize Microsoft Access, we consider this to be the exception as opposed to the policy. The majority of Microsoft Gain access to data sources are developed by end-users and never ever should finish to the following degree. Applying a method to produce every end-user data source "professionally" would certainly be a massive waste of resources.

For the uncommon Microsoft Access data sources that are so effective that they need to develop, SQL Server supplies the following all-natural development. Without shedding the existing investment in the application (table styles, data, inquiries, forms, records, macros and modules), data can be relocated to SQL Server and also the Access database linked to it. Once in SQL Server, various other platforms such as Aesthetic Studio.NET can be made use of to produce Windows, web and/or mobile remedies. The Access database application might be entirely replaced or a hybrid remedy may be created.

For more information, review our paper Microsoft Gain access to within an Organization's General Data source Method.

Microsoft Gain Access To and also SQL Database Architectures

Microsoft Accessibility is the premier desktop computer database item readily available for Microsoft Windows. Given that its intro in 1992, Gain access to has provided a functional system for novices and power individuals to develop single-user as well as small workgroup data source applications.

Microsoft Gain access to has actually enjoyed wonderful success since it originated the principle of stepping customers with a difficult task with using Wizards. This, along with an instinctive query designer, one of the best desktop computer coverage tools and also the addition of macros and a coding environment, all contribute to making Access the best selection for desktop computer data source advancement.

Considering that Access is created to be easy to use and approachable, it was never ever meant as a platform for the most trustworthy as well as durable applications. Generally, upsizing must occur when these characteristics come to be critical for the application. Fortunately, the flexibility of Access enables you to upsize to SQL Server in a range of ways, from a quick cost-efficient, data-moving circumstance to full application redesign.

Gain access to supplies a rich selection of information architectures that allow it to manage data in a variety of methods. When taking into consideration an upsizing task, it is necessary to understand the selection of methods Gain access to may be set up to utilize its native Jet database format as well as SQL Server in both single and multi-user settings.

Gain access to and the Jet Engine
Microsoft Access has its very own database engine-- the Microsoft Jet Data source Engine (additionally called the ACE with Gain access to 2007's introduction of the ACCDB format). Jet was designed from the starting to support solitary user and also multiuser data sharing on a computer network. Databases have an optimum size of 2 GB, although an Access database could connect to various other databases through connected tables as well as several backend databases to workaround the 2 GB restriction.

But Access is more than a data source engine. It is also an application advancement setting that allows individuals to develop questions, produce kinds and also records, and compose macros and also Visual Fundamental for Applications (VBA) component code to automate an application. In its default configuration, Gain access to utilizes Jet inside to save its style things such as forms, reports, macros, as well as modules as well as makes use of Jet to save all table data.

One of the main advantages of Accessibility upsizing is that you could upgrade your application to continuously use its forms, reports, macros and also components, and also change the Jet Engine with SQL Server. This enables the most effective of both globes: the simplicity of use of Gain access to with the dependability as well as security of SQL Server.

Prior to you attempt to convert an Access database to SQL Server, make sure you understand:

Which applications belong in Microsoft Gain access to vs. SQL Server? Not every database needs to be changed.
The factors for upsizing your data source. Make certain SQL Server gives you what you look for.

The tradeoffs for doing so. There are pluses and also minuses relying on exactly what you're attempting to optimize. Make sure you are not migrating to SQL Server only for efficiency factors.
In a lot of cases, efficiency lowers when an application is upsized, especially for reasonably tiny data sources (under 200 MB).

Some efficiency issues are unassociated to the backend database. Improperly designed questions and table style won't be fixed by upsizing. Microsoft Accessibility tables supply some attributes that SQL Server tables do not such as an automated refresh when the information changes. SQL Server calls for an explicit requery.

Choices for Moving Microsoft Accessibility to SQL Server
There are several alternatives for hosting SQL Server data sources:

A local circumstances of SQL Express, which is a free version of SQL Server can be set up on each individual's maker

A common SQL Server data source on your network

A cloud host such as SQL Azure. Cloud hosts have protection that restriction which IP addresses can retrieve information, so fixed IP addresses and/or VPN is needed.
There are numerous means to upsize your Microsoft Gain access to databases to SQL Server:

Relocate the data to SQL Server and link to it from your Access database while protecting the existing Access application.
Adjustments could be should support SQL Server queries and also differences from Accessibility databases.
Transform an Access MDB data source to an Accessibility Information Project (ADP) that attaches directly to a SQL Server database.
Since ADPs were deprecated in Accessibility 2013, we do not suggest this option.
Use Microsoft Access with MS Azure.
With Office365, your data is posted right into a SQL Server data source held by SQL Azure with an Accessibility Internet front end
Suitable for basic watching as well as modifying of information throughout the web
However, Accessibility Web Applications do not have the personalization features similar to VBA in Gain access to desktop services
Move the entire application to the.NET Framework, ASP.NET, as well as SQL Server platform, or Visit This Link recreate it on SharePoint.
A hybrid solution that puts the information in SQL Server with another front-end plus a Gain access to front-end data source.
SQL Server can be the standard variation hosted on a venture quality web server or a complimentary SQL Server Express version set this link up on your COMPUTER

Data source Challenges in an Organization

Every company has to conquer data source challenges to meet their goal. These challenges include:
• Making best use of return on investment
• Managing human resources
• Fast deployment
• Flexibility and maintainability
• Scalability (additional).


Taking Full Advantage Of Roi.

Making best use of roi is more vital than ever. Monitoring requires substantial outcomes for the pricey financial investments in data source application development. Many data source development initiatives fail to generate the results they assure. Selecting the appropriate technology and method for each and every level in a company is crucial to taking full advantage of return on investment. This implies picking the very best total return, which does not suggest selecting the least costly initial remedy. This is typically the most important choice a chief information officer (CIO) or chief technology policeman (CTO) makes.

Handling Human Resources.

Managing individuals to customize technology is challenging. The more facility the modern technology or application, the less people are qualified to handle it, as well as the much more costly they are to employ. Turn over is constantly an issue, and also having the right requirements is essential to efficiently supporting heritage applications. Training as well as staying up to date with modern technology are additionally testing.


Quick Implementation.

Developing database applications swiftly is very important, not just for lowering costs, but also for responding to internal or customer needs. The ability to develop applications promptly gives a significant competitive advantage.

The IT supervisor is accountable for offering alternatives and also making tradeoffs to sustain the business demands of the organization. By using different technologies, you can use organisation choice manufacturers selections, such as a 60 percent option in 3 months, a 90 percent service in twelve months, or a 99 percent option in twenty-four months. (As opposed to months, it could be dollars.) Often, time to market is most vital, various other times it could be price, and also go various other times features or protection are essential. Requirements alter promptly and also are uncertain. We reside in a "good enough" instead of a best globe, so understanding the best ways to deliver "adequate" solutions swiftly gives you as well as your organization a competitive edge.


Adaptability and Maintainability.
Despite having the very best system layout, by the time several month growth initiatives are completed, requires change. Versions adhere to versions, and also a system that's created to be flexible as well as able to suit modification can imply the distinction between success as well as failing for the individuals' professions.

Scalability.

Equipment ought to be made to manage the anticipated information as well as more. Yet several systems are never ever finished, are thrown out quickly, or change so much over time that the initial evaluations are wrong. Scalability is very important, however often less important compared to a quick solution. If the application effectively supports development, scalability can be included later when it's economically warranted.

Leave a Reply

Your email address will not be published. Required fields are marked *